The soil moisture sensor can read the amount of moisture present in the surrounding soil. Ideal for monitoring an urban garden or the water level of your potted plant. This sensor is essential for an IoT garden/Agriculture!

The new soil moisture sensor uses an Immersion Gold plug that protects the nickel from oxidation. It has several advantages over more conventional coatings like HASL, including excellent flat surface, good oxidation resistance, and usability on untreated contact surfaces.

This Arduino soil moisture sensor uses two protrusions to pass current through the soil and then reads the resistance to determine the moisture level. More water makes the soil more conductive, while dry soil has higher resistance. This sensor will be useful to remind you to water your indoor plants or monitor the soil moisture in your garden.

For easier use of this sensor, a Gravity interface has been adapted to allow for direct connection. The Arduino IO expansion shield is the best option for this sensor. It can operate at 3.3V, making it compatible with Raspberry Pi, Intel Edison, Joule, and Curie.

Note: If you plan to place the sensor in very moist soil, this may cause surface corrosion of the sensor in a few days, so the use of the analog soil moisture sensor - Corrosion Resistant is recommended.

  • Power supply: 3.3V or 5V
  • Output signal: 0~4.2V
  • Current: 35mA
  • Connection:
    • Analog output (Blue wire)
    • Ground (Black wire)
    • Power supply (Red wire)
  • Dimensions: 60x20x5mm
  • Surface: Immersion Gold

Included: Moisture sensor x1, Analog sensor cable x1
